How they compare
Ecuador currently reports 1,256 millions against 965.56 millions in Uruguay, a difference of 290.44 millions.
That makes Ecuador's figure about 1.3 times Uruguay's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 15 shared years of data; in 1984 it was Ecuador ahead.
Ecuador ranks 57th and Uruguay ranks 60th of 159 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 3 and Uruguay in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ecuador | Urugu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 420.02 millions | 175.28 millions | 244.73 millions | Ecuador |
| 1990s | 153.77 millions | 246.73 millions | 92.97 millions | Uruguay |
| 2000s | 33.97 millions | 225.19 millions | 191.22 millions | Uruguay |
| 2010s | 1,792 millions | 790.48 millions | 1,002 millions | Ecuador |
| 2020s | 1,219 millions | 879.38 millions | 339.21 millions | Ecuador |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
